Understanding Different Types of Architectural Lighting 1. Ambient Lighting Ambient lighting provides overall illumination to a space. This is essential in both indoor settings and outdoor environments. Purpose: To create an inviting atmosphere. Examples: Ceiling fixtures indoors or soft landscape lights outdoors. 2. Task Lighting Task lighting focuses on specific areas where activities take place. Purpose: To facilitate tasks like reading or cooking. Examples: Under-cabinet lights in kitchens or pathway lighting solutions outdoors. 3. Accent Lighting Accent lighting is used to highlight specific features—be it artwork inside your home or a beautiful tree in your garden. Purpose: To draw attention to focal points. Examples: Spotlights on sculptures or LED landscape lights highlighting garden features. Key Components of Smart Lighting Controls To understand how smart lighting works, it's important to recognize its key components: 1. Sensors Sensors play a crucial role in smart lighting systems by detecting movement, ambient light levels, or even weather conditions. Motion Sensors: Activate lights when someone approaches. Ambient Light Sensors: Adjust brightness based on surrounding light levels. 2. Controllers Controllers are the brains behind smart systems, allowing users to communicate with their lights via smartphones or voice assistants like Amazon Alexa or Google Home. 3. Fixtures and Bulbs LED bulbs and fixtures used in these systems are often designed for longevity and efficiency, making them perfect candidates for https://beaufekj976.quantlynix.com/posts/low-voltage-landscape-lighting-the-perfect-solution-for-any-garden residential lighting services and commercial installations alike. 4. Mobile Applications Most smart lighting systems come with user-friendly apps that allow you to control every aspect of your outdoor illumination from your smartphone or tablet. Understanding Low-Voltage Landscape Lighting Low-voltage landscape lighting operates on 12 volts rather than the standard 120 volts found in traditional electrical systems. This not only makes it safer to install but also significantly reduces energy consumption. But what does this mean for your home? Benefits of Low-Voltage Systems Safety: The lower voltage minimizes the risk of electrical shock. Energy Efficiency: Utilizing less power results in lower electricity bills. Flexibility: Easy installation allows for adjusting fixtures without extensive rewiring. Durability: Designed to withstand outdoor conditions, low-voltage lights are built for longevity. Landscape Lighting Design Principles Creating an effective landscape lighting design requires careful planning and thoughtfulness. Here are key principles to consider: Highlighting Key Features Identify prominent features within your yard—trees, sculptures, or water features—and plan your lighting around them. Layering Light Sources Employ multiple types of lights (e.g., ambient, task, accent) to add depth and dimension to your space. Creating Balance Ensure that light distribution feels balanced throughout the area; avoid overly bright spots or dark shadows. Utilizing Natural Elements Incorporate existing trees or structures into your design by using uplighting techniques that showcase their beauty at night. Outdoor Lighting Installation Guide Installing low-voltage landscape lighting is more accessible than many might think. Here’s a step-by-step guide: Step 1: Planning Your Layout Map out where you want the lights placed based on your desired effect—safety versus ambiance—and mark these spots. Step 2: Choosing Fixtures Select fixtures that suit your style preferences while being functional for the intended purpose (e.g., pathway vs. accent). Step 3: Running Wires Lay out cables along designated paths while ensuring they remain hidden from view yet accessible for future maintenance. Step 4: Completing Connections Connect each fixture according to manufacturer instructions; use waterproof connections when necessary. Step 5: Testing & Adjusting Before finalizing installations, test all lights and make any necessary adjustments for optimal effect.
